harley carb issue? ideas needed please?
i have a 96 sportster with a 1200 kit, high compression pistons, over sized jet kit, mild cams, and a hyper charger. here lately after its warmed up sometimes when its cruising at a constant speed (50 and up)it spits and sputters on the highway cutting out spontanously. Accelerating stops it from sputtering. it tends to run better the lower the rpm. when i accelerate quickly it sputters for a fraction of a second then takes off like its supposed to. i noticed a little choke helps but doesn’t cure the problem. it doesnt do this all the time. some days it will run fine others its like a turd. lol any ideas to prevent me from going to the harley shop is very appreciated
Fuel starved, likely causes
Sticky float needle
Clogged / obstructed main jet
Clogged / obstructed fuel filter (at petcock in tank)
Pull the float bowl, look for debris clean main and pilot jets
Remove float needle and clean orifice
Remove petcock and clean filter.
You may also want to check for an air leak at the manifold, but the intermittent nature sounds like junk in the float bowl.
